New police checkpoints set up in Bangkok

BANGKOK: -- More police checkpoints will be set up in the Thai capital and maximum security at embassies will be imposed following a warning by Prime Minister Surayud Chulanont that more explosives could be set off in the coming months, a senior police officer said on Saturday.

Senior Bangkok police officers were ordered by Pol. Maj. Gen. Kamol Kaewsuwan, Metropolitan Police deputy commissioner, to double the number of security checkpoints from the 42 presently operated to 84, to be manned by police, military personnel and volunteers round-the-clock.

Maximum security will be in force at embassies, together with as many as 300 shopping malls, entertainment venues and ports.

Bangkok police will also ask for help from the Ministry of Information and Communication Technology for more efficient monitoring and tracing of telephone calls relating to bomb threats and other security incidents which have been creating confusion since last Sundays bombings, which left three persons killed and 42 others wounded, including nine foreigners.

--TNA 2007-01-06
